    This private day tour blends two of Victoria’s most loved experiences – a heritage steam train ride through the forest, and an up-close visit with some of Australia’s most iconic wildlife. Puffing Billy is a scenic, slow-moving train that winds its way through tall mountain ash trees and fern gullies in the Dandenong Ranges.

    At Healesville Sanctuary, you’ll get the chance to meet koalas, kangaroos, wombats, echidnas and more – all in a bushland setting that feels worlds away from the city. It’s relaxed, family-friendly, and full of local character.

    This tour is great for families, nature lovers, or anyone wanting to escape the city for a day and breathe in some fresh mountain air. Puffing Billy is one of Australia’s oldest and most charming steam trains, and Healesville Sanctuary is the best place near Melbourne to see native animals in a natural setting.

    You’ll be picked up in the morning and head east into the hills. First stop: Puffing Billy, where you’ll hop aboard for a relaxed ride through the forest. It’s all open-air carriages, classic charm and great views. You can even dangle your legs over the side if you feel like it.

    After the train, it’s off to Healesville Sanctuary – a wildlife park set in the bush, where you’ll see animals like kangaroos, dingoes, emus, platypus, and wombats up close. It’s a great chance to get photos, learn a bit about conservation, and maybe even spot a few joeys.

    There’ll be time to stop for lunch at a local café (own expense), take some quiet walks, and enjoy the peaceful pace of the Dandenongs.
